Taman Shud Case / Somerton Man
https://secure.wikimedia.org/wikipedia/en/wiki/Taman_Shud_Case
"The Taman Shud Case, also known as the "Mystery of the Somerton Man", is an unsolved case revolving around an unidentified man found dead at 6:30a.m., December 1, 1948, on Somerton beach in Adelaide, Australia.
Considered "one of Australia's most profound mysteries", the case has been the subject of intense speculation over the years regarding the identity of the victim, the events leading up to his death and the cause of death."
Oklahoma Girl Scout Murders
http://www.girlscoutmurders.com/index.php

"The Oklahoma Girl Scout Murders is an unresolved crime in rural Mayes County, Oklahoma. On a rainy, late-spring night in 1977, three girls—ages 8, 9, and 10—were raped and murdered and their bodies left in the woods near their tent at summer camp. Although the case was classified as "solved" when Gene Leroy Hart, a local jail escapee with a history of violence was arrested, and stood trial for the crime, he was acquitted. Thirty years later authorities conducted new DNA testing, but the results of these proved inconclusive, as the samples were too old."

The Red Room
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Red_Room_%28animation%29
"Red Room is an interactive Adobe Flash horror animation, entirely in Japanese, about an urban legend called "the Red Room". The protagonist searches on the Internet for proof of its existence, only for the results to go horribly wrong. It can be considered a prank flash because of an unexpected occurrence that takes place after the video ends.
This flash video became notorious when it was discovered to be the favorite of the Japanese schoolgirl who committed the Sasebo slashing on 1 June 2004"
